it's cool and all but if your goal is to move people less than 500 miles, wouldn't an electric mag-lift train be much safer and more efficient? It's extremely fast, less complex than piloting an airplane plus no take off or landing. This is why the car/plane idea from the 50's didn't take off. A pilot has to constantly communicate with ATC, thoroughly understand weather condition and be able to navigate under VFR, IFR not to mention all the flight checks and the physical act of flying the plane. An electric plane isn't going to make flying more practical for the masses.
The only reason this might be useful is when you must travel from small island to island where it would be too expensive for the government to build bridges and connecting railways.
